三網(wǎng)融合下個性化數(shù)字資源云服務(wù)研究
發(fā)布時間:2018-11-15 12:37
【摘要】:隨著信息技術(shù)和三網(wǎng)融合的迅速發(fā)展,互聯(lián)網(wǎng)、電信網(wǎng)和廣播電視網(wǎng)業(yè)務(wù)正在加速融合,在不同網(wǎng)絡(luò)平臺中產(chǎn)生了海量的數(shù)據(jù)資源,現(xiàn)有數(shù)字圖書館無法支撐如此龐大的數(shù)據(jù)業(yè)務(wù)處理,并且用戶很難獲取到個性化的圖書資源,傳統(tǒng)的圖書信息服務(wù)方式受到很大挑戰(zhàn)。為了解決上述問題,本文從數(shù)字圖書館、三網(wǎng)融合的現(xiàn)狀出發(fā),將云計算技術(shù)應(yīng)用到三網(wǎng)融合下數(shù)字資源云服務(wù)平臺建設(shè)中,提出三網(wǎng)融合下數(shù)字資源云服務(wù)平臺架構(gòu)和數(shù)字資源提供方式,能夠為區(qū)域內(nèi)用戶和圖書館提供個性化數(shù)字資源、平臺資源、管理服務(wù)資源為一體的綜合性服務(wù),為三網(wǎng)融合環(huán)境下區(qū)域數(shù)字圖書館建設(shè)奠定基礎(chǔ)。本文主要工作如下:(1)提出三網(wǎng)融合環(huán)境下數(shù)字資源云服務(wù)平臺架構(gòu),該平臺架構(gòu)包括數(shù)字資源提供層、IaaS層、PaaS層、SaaS層、融合網(wǎng)絡(luò)層、用戶服務(wù)層,能將三網(wǎng)融合環(huán)境下的分布式數(shù)字圖書資源跨庫整合,形成一個自適應(yīng)的數(shù)字資源云平臺,并將數(shù)字資源以Widget服務(wù)提供給三網(wǎng)融合下的用戶,該平臺架構(gòu)能夠支撐異構(gòu)網(wǎng)絡(luò)和異構(gòu)終端場景。(2)利用數(shù)字資源云服務(wù)領(lǐng)域本體建立偏好樹,構(gòu)建了三網(wǎng)融合環(huán)境下的圖書用戶模型和資源云服務(wù)模型,模型包括偏好和資源上下文。并根據(jù)三網(wǎng)融合下用戶的功能性需求,提出基于資源云服務(wù)功能屬性的個性化推薦方法,為三網(wǎng)融合下的用戶提供個性化數(shù)字資源云服務(wù)。(3)在OWL_S_QoS+定義的基礎(chǔ)上,提出用戶上下文本體和資源云服務(wù)上下文本體,能夠支撐混合數(shù)據(jù)類型描述三網(wǎng)融合環(huán)境下動態(tài)不確定的QoS偏好,并根據(jù)三網(wǎng)融合下用戶的非功能性需求,提出基于資源云服務(wù)非功能屬性的服務(wù)選擇方法,該方法利用協(xié)同過濾算法為三網(wǎng)融合下的用戶提供個性化數(shù)字資源云服務(wù)。
[Abstract]:With the rapid development of information technology and the integration of three networks, the Internet, telecommunications network and radio and television network services are speeding up integration, which has produced massive data resources in different network platforms. The existing digital library can not support such a huge data business processing, and it is difficult for users to obtain personalized book resources. The traditional library information service has been greatly challenged. In order to solve the above problems, this paper applies cloud computing technology to the construction of cloud service platform of digital resources under the condition of digital library and three-network convergence. This paper puts forward the architecture of digital resource cloud service platform and the mode of providing digital resources under the combination of three networks, which can provide the integrated services of personalized digital resources, platform resources and management services resources for the users and libraries in the region. It lays a foundation for the construction of regional digital library under the environment of three networks integration. The main work of this paper is as follows: (1) the architecture of digital resource cloud service platform under the environment of three-network convergence is proposed. The platform architecture includes digital resource providing layer, IaaS layer, PaaS layer, SaaS layer, integrated network layer, user service layer, and so on. The distributed digital book resources in the environment of three-network convergence can be integrated across libraries to form an adaptive cloud platform of digital resources, and the digital resources can be provided to the users under the three-network convergence with Widget services. The platform architecture can support heterogeneous networks and heterogeneous terminal scenarios. (2) using the domain ontology of digital resource cloud services to establish a preference tree, the book user model and resource cloud service model under the environment of three-network convergence are constructed. The model includes preference and resource context. According to the functional requirements of the users under the three-network convergence, a personalized recommendation method based on the functional attributes of the resource cloud services is proposed to provide personalized digital resource cloud services for the users under the three-network convergence. (3) based on the definition of OWL_S_QoS, a personalized recommendation method is proposed. A user context ontology and a resource cloud service context ontology are proposed, which can support the hybrid data types to describe the dynamic and uncertain QoS preferences in a three-network convergence environment, and according to the non-functional requirements of the users under the three-network convergence environment. A service selection method based on the non-functional attributes of resource cloud services is proposed. The collaborative filtering algorithm is used to provide personalized digital resource cloud services for users under the three-network convergence.
